It is important to keep your teeth clean not only for aesthetic reasons but also for your overall health. Poor oral health can lead to serious health problems, such as heart disease if the bacteria or inflammation is left unchecked. It’s important to take care of your teeth by brushing and flossing daily and by going to the dentist regularly.
Here are five basic oral hygiene practices you should know:
1. Brushing Twice a Day and Flossing Daily
Brushing teeth twice daily and flossing daily are important for keeping your mouth healthy. Not taking care of your mouth can lead to serious problems like gum disease or tooth extraction. Our dentists recommend that you brush your teeth for two minutes twice a day and floss at least once a day. Proper technique is key to getting your teeth clean.
To brush your teeth correctly, start by holding the toothbrush at a slight angle. Gently move the brush in circular, short back-and-forth motions. Be sure to brush all surfaces of your teeth and do not brush too hard. Brush your teeth for two minutes. To floss properly, be gentle when moving the floss between your teeth. Make sure to floss one tooth at a time, and avoid snapping the floss into your gums. Instead, guide the floss using a rubbing motion.
2. Limiting on Sugary Drinks
It’s okay to have a sugary drink now and then, but too much sugar can lead to cavities. Try to limit yourself to one sugary drink per day. Drinking water is the most important thing you can do for your health. If you want to drink sugary beverages, limit them to mealtimes and brush your teeth before bed.
3. Using Products with Fluoride
Failing to use fluoride when caring for your teeth is a mistake that can lead to serious oral health problems. Fluoride is a naturally occurring mineral that is effective in preventing cavities. Many kinds of toothpaste and mouthwashes contain fluoride, so be sure to use products that contain this important ingredient.
Fluoride products are safe and can help improve oral hygiene and prevent tooth decay. Fluoride products can help reduce disease risk when combined with regular brushing and flossing.
4. Not Smoking
Smoking cigarettes can cause many negative health effects, including damage to your lungs and respiratory system, tooth discoloration, and an increased risk of oral cancer. Quitting smoking is beneficial for oral health, no matter how long you have been smoking. Your teeth and gums will be much healthier if you stop smoking.
5. Visiting Your Dentist Every Six Months
Dentists focus on preventive care by recommending that patients come for teeth cleaning every six months. This allows for the removal of plaque and tartar buildup and provides an opportunity for the dentist to check in with the patient regarding any concerns or changes in oral health.
